R v Terence Llewellyn
Ben Lawrence prosecuted a man who was accused of sexual offences against four victims over more than two decades.
His crimes were eventually reported in 2015 and 2016 and the defendant denied a total of 37 historic sexual offences when he went on trial at Stoke-on-Trent Crown Court.
Following a 12-day trial, 81-year-old Terence Llewellyn was found guilty on 36 counts and jailed for 24 years.
